@joboaler youcubed.org getting all kids inspired by math:

summary:

Stanford Mathematics Education Professor 

https://ed.stanford.edu/faculty/joboaler

Jo Boaler, promotes inclusive math training

that shows all kids they have a brain for math.

. her resources include the website youcubed.org

that includes a free online student course.

https://www.youcubed.org/online-student-course/

. she has several videos explaining her way,

along with many books.

*Proposed Specification of ORU-DRR Robot:* 
* The robot’s joints axes, electric devices, gear unit and power unit
should be liquid and dust proof.
*The robot should be about 6ft tall and weighs about 160 pounds.
* The inner frame should be aluminum
and the outer body wrap in fire resistance composite. 
* Multi-finger hands for effective handling of tools.
*   Integrate smooth gait generation and slip detection technology
to enable robot to walk on low-friction surface.
 *Sophisticated whole body movement to be realized by
 AIST-developed “generalized ZMP” technology.
 * 42 Degrees of freedom – Head: 2 axes (pitch and yam);
 Arm: 7 axes (shoulder: 3, elbow: 1, wrist: 3) X 2;
 Hand: 6 axes x2; Waist 2 axes (pitch and yaw); Leg 6 axes x2.
 * Vision sensor: 4-lens stereo camera system for autonomous control;
 4-lens stereo camera for remote control; scanning range finder.
 * Control system: Distributed control system;
 Network: Can (Controller Area Network – Mbps).

Our DARPA Challenge Robotics Platform!!
Open Robotics University applied to participate in
tracks C and D of the DARPA Robotics Challenge.
DARPA’s goal is to accelerate the development of robots
that are robust enough to be used for
disaster response operations in hazardous environment.
The robot should also be
intelligent enough to navigate around
doors, chairs, manipulate vehicles,
power tools and recognize levers and valves.
To meet this goal we have adopted
Kawada industries’ HRP-3 MK-II Robotics platform
for research to build our robot ORU-DRR Robot.
Since we are an open-source university,
talented individuals that are not members of our faculty
or not enrolled as a student in our university
worldwide can join our Open Robotics University team
to design software and robot for the competition
(Check out the proposed specification of ORU-DRR below) .

. Powell Center for Economic Literacy is a resource for teachers and students
with lesson plans, and curricula for economics,
and information on learning opportunities in the field of economics.
